DIVIDEND DECLARATION

 

The Board of Triple Point Energy Transition plc (ticker: TENT), the London
listed infrastructure investment company supporting the energy transition, has
declared an interim dividend in respect of the period from 1 January 2023 to
31 March 2023 of 1.375 pence per Ordinary Share, payable on or around 14 July
2023 to holders of Ordinary Shares on the register on 30 June 2023. The
ex-dividend date will be 29 June 2023.

 

A portion of the Company's dividends will be designated as an interest
distribution for UK tax purposes. The interest streaming percentage for the
dividend is 73.1%.

NOTES:

 

The Company is an investment trust which aims to invest in assets that support
the transition to a lower carbon, more efficient energy system and help the UK
achieve Net Zero.

Since its IPO in October 2020, the Company has made the following investments
and commitments:

 

·    Harvest and Glasshouse: provision of £21m of senior debt finance to
two established combined heat and power ("CHP") assets, located on the Isle of
Wight, supplying heat, electricity and carbon dioxide to the UK's largest
tomato grower, APS Salads ("APS") - March 2021

·    Spark Steam: provision of £8m of senior debt finance to an
established CHP asset in Teesside supplying APS, as well as a further power
purchase agreement through a private wire arrangement with another food
manufacturer - June 2021

·    Hydroelectric Portfolio (1): acquisition of six operational, Feed in
Tariff ("FiT") accredited, "run of the river" hydroelectric power projects in
Scotland, with total installed capacity of 4.1MW, for an aggregate
consideration of £26.6m (excluding costs) - November 2021

·    Hydroelectric Portfolio (2): acquisition of a further three
operational, FiT accredited, "run of the river" hydroelectric power projects
in Scotland, with total installed capacity of 2.5MW, for an aggregate
consideration of £19.6m (excluding costs) - December 2021

·    BESS Portfolio: commitment to provide a debt facility of £45.6m to a
subsidiary of Virmati Energy Ltd (trading as "Field"), for the purposes of
building a portfolio of four geographically diverse Battery Energy Storage
System ("BESS") assets in the UK with a total capacity of 110MW - March 2022

·    Energy Efficient Lighting (1): Funding of c.£1m to a lighting
solutions provider to install efficient lighting and controls at a leading
logistics company - September 2022.

·    Energy Efficient Lighting (2): Commitment of c.£1m to a lighting
solutions provider to install efficient lighting and controls at a leading
logistics company, of which £0.3m invested to date - November 2022.

·    Innova: Provision of a £5m short term development financing
facility to Innova Renewables, building out a portfolio of Solar and BESS
assets across the UK - March 2023

 

The Investment Manager is Triple Point Investment Management LLP ("Triple
Point") which is authorised and reg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ority.
Triple Point manages private, institutional, and public capital, and has a
proven track record of investment in energy transition and decentralised
energy projects.

 

Following its IPO on 19 October 2020, the Company was admitted to trading on
the Premium Segment of the Main Market of the London Stock Exchange on 28
October 2022. The Company was also awarded the London Stock Exchange's Green
Economy Mark.
